Abstract

The evolving landscape of mining necessitates a paradigm shift in worker communication, moving beyond traditional methods to ensure safety, efficiency, and real-time responsiveness. This research explores the transformative potential of IoT-enabled smart helmets in achieving seamless connectivity for mining personnel. By integrating sensor networks, augmented reality displays, and robust communication protocols into a single wearable device, we investigate how these helmets can facilitate contextualized information sharing, proactive hazard alerts, and dynamic task management. This study diverges from existing research by focusing on the holistic integration of these technologies, analyzing the impact on worker cognition and collaborative decision-making within the inherently challenging mining environment. Through a combination of simulated and field-based evaluations, we assess the efficacy of this smart helmet system in enhancing situational awareness, reducing communication latency, and fostering a safer, more connected future for mining workers. This research ultimately aims to demonstrate the viability of a truly integrated, worker-centric communication ecosystem, paving the way for a new era of intelligent mining operations.
